Bagworms start hatching in Kansas somewhere between late May and mid-June, and the window to stop them with anything other than scissors and a trash bag closes fast once the larvae build their protective cases. If you’ve got junipers, arborvitae, or eastern redcedar on your property, the next six weeks after hatch decide whether you lose a few branches or lose the whole tree.
When Bagworms Actually Show Up in Kansas

Bagworm eggs overwinter inside last year’s bags, glued tight to twigs and branches. Nothing happens until soil and air temperatures climb enough to trigger hatch, which entomologists track using growing degree days rather than the calendar. In practice, that means eastern Kansas cities like Kansas City, Topeka, and Wichita usually see the first larvae emerge a week or two ahead of western towns like Garden City or Dodge City, where spring warms up more slowly.
Most years, hatch runs from the last week of May through mid-June statewide. A cool, wet spring can push that date back into late June. A hot, dry one moves it earlier. This matters because the newly hatched larvae are barely an eighth of an inch long, soft-bodied, and vulnerable, they’re exposed and easy to kill for only a short stretch before they spin the silk bags that make them nearly bulletproof against most sprays.
What Bagworms Actually Damage
Kansas has an unusual amount of bagworm habitat baked into its landscape. Eastern redcedar, a native juniper that has spread aggressively across pastures and windbreaks statewide, is one of the insect’s favorite hosts. So are the arborvitae hedges planted around thousands of farmsteads for wind protection. Ornamental junipers in suburban yards round out the short list of “preferred” targets.
But bagworms aren’t picky when populations get heavy. They’ll feed on more than 100 species of trees and shrubs, including maple, honeylocust, sycamore, and black locust. The difference is survival odds. A maple or sycamore that gets stripped of leaves in August will usually push out new growth the following spring. An evergreen like juniper or arborvitae doesn’t have that luxury. Conifers don’t regenerate foliage the same way broadleaf trees do, so a heavy bagworm year can leave brown, dead branches that never come back, and a severe enough infestation can kill the whole tree in a single season, especially one already stressed by drought.
That drought connection matters more in Kansas than in wetter states. A juniper hedge that’s already struggling through a dry summer has fewer reserves to recover from defoliation. In practice, that means the same bagworm population can be a cosmetic nuisance on a well-watered tree and a death sentence on a stressed one thirty feet away.
How to Spot an Infestation Before It Spreads
The bags themselves change shape and size as the season progresses, which throws off a lot of homeowners doing a quick inspection. In June, look for tiny, spindle-shaped cases covered in bits of foliage, easy to mistake for a piece of debris caught on a branch. By August and September, those same bags have grown to an inch and a half or two inches long and start to resemble small, dangling pine cones woven from silk and twigs.
Old bags from the previous year are the giveaway to watch for before hatch even starts. They stay attached to branches through winter, gray and weathered, often mistaken for old seed pods. A juniper or arborvitae with dozens of these hanging on it going into spring is a tree that’s about to have a bad summer unless someone intervenes.
Signs the Damage Is Already Underway
Thinning foliage on the interior branches, brown patches that don’t match a normal seasonal color shift, and visible webbing near feeding sites all point to an active population. On evergreens especially, damage tends to show up from the top and outer branches inward, since that’s where larvae feed first before spreading.
What Actually Stops Bagworms in Kansas
Timing decides everything here. Bacillus thuringiensis (Bt), the biological insecticide most often recommended for bagworms, only works on small larvae actively feeding on foliage. Once a caterpillar has built enough of its bag to retreat inside, the spray can’t reach it and the treatment fails. That gives homeowners roughly a two to four week window after hatch, generally mid-June through early July across most of Kansas, to apply Bt or spinosad while it can still do its job.
Miss that window and the options narrow. Contact insecticides such as pyrethroids or carbaryl can still knock back larger larvae, but they’re less selective and more likely to harm beneficial insects like bees and predatory wasps that help keep other pest populations in check. Spraying in August, when bags are near full size, tends to produce disappointing results no matter what product gets used.
The single most reliable method, and the one that costs nothing but time, is hand removal during the dormant season. Picking bags off branches between November and February, before eggs hatch, physically eliminates the next generation before it starts. A single bag can hold anywhere from a few hundred to over a thousand eggs, so removing even a modest number of bags from a hedge can prevent a serious outbreak the following summer. Bags need to go into the trash or get burned, not the compost pile, since the eggs inside can survive composting and hatch right back into the yard.
For homeowners managing a windbreak of dozens or hundreds of trees, hand-picking every bag isn’t realistic. In those cases, scouting a sample of trees in late winter to gauge population size helps decide whether a coordinated spray program is worth the cost come June.
Regional Differences Across Kansas
Central and eastern Kansas, where eastern redcedar has spread the most aggressively into former grassland, tend to see the heaviest and most consistent bagworm pressure. The sheer volume of juniper habitat gives populations more places to build up year over year. Western Kansas has less native redcedar density, but farmstead windbreaks planted decades ago, often rows of arborvitae or juniper meant to block wind and snow, can take serious hits since they’re isolated stands with nowhere else for the insect to disperse.
Urban and suburban plantings add another wrinkle. Ornamental junipers used in landscaping around homes in Wichita, Overland Park, and other cities create small, concentrated pockets of host material, and heat retained by pavement and buildings can nudge local hatch dates slightly earlier than in surrounding rural areas.
A Practical Timeline for Kansas Yards
Late winter, roughly February through early March, is the best time to walk juniper, arborvitae, and cedar plantings and strip off any remaining bags before hatch. Early May is the point to start watching for the first signs of hatch, particularly in warmer eastern counties. Mid-June through early July is the narrow treatment window if a Bt or spinosad application makes sense based on population size. By late summer, the focus shifts from treatment to damage assessment, deciding which branches or trees need pruning, extra watering, or replacement going into next year.
One detail that surprises a lot of Kansas homeowners: a tree that looks fine in July can still be carrying a population that does real damage by September, since bagworms keep feeding and growing right up until they seal themselves in for winter. A midsummer check that comes back clean isn’t a guarantee the season is over.
